This lodge, affectionately named after the Eulophiella
orchid which is found in Madagascar, is situated in a remote
location, in close proximity to the Andasibe Reserve. This
provides guests with a close encounter with Malagasy wildlife.
The lodge boasts sixteen immaculate thatched chalets, ten
of which are made of wood, with the remaining six being brick
walled. All the chalets have ensuite facilities. Also, there
are verandas where guests can sit during the day and soak
up some sunlight, while listening to he call of the Indri.
There is also a lounge and dining area with a large verandah,
where guests can take meals can be taken, whilst looking out
into the forest.
This lodge is secluded and provides the peace and tranquility
of the rainforest, where a wide selection of wildlife can
be seen, such as the Indri, which is the largest of the lemur
family and is native to Madagascar.
